Be Kind

Photo by Philip Justin Mamelic on Pexels.com

Kindness, like honesty, is often overlooked or taken for granted. It is sometimes seen as being pretentious. Other times, it is seen as a sign of weakness. The world wants someone who is strong, powerful, and ruthless.

The Bible tells us kindness is a fruit of the spirit. It is not just a gift we give to others; it is also a blessing that boomerangs back to us.

“Those who are kind benefit themselves, but the cruel bring ruin on themselves.” (Pro 11:17)

When we choose to be kind, we reflect the heart of God. His kindness towards us is unmeasurable. It is seen most clearly in the gift of his son, Jesus Christ. We are his children are called to imitate his love and compassion in our interactions with others. An act of kindness – be it a warm smile, an encouraging word, or a helping hand – points people to the goodness of God and testify of his transforming grace.

As mentioned earlier, kindness does not just impact those we serve. It changes us too. When we extend kindness to others, our hearts grow softer, our relationship deepens, and we experience the joy of living in alignment with God’s will. Kindness brings peace to our lives and helps us see others as God sees them – valuable and loved.

Let us commit to be kind. It may take some time. Look for opportunity to serve, uplift, and encourage. When we do that, we will reflect God’s character and share his love with a world in need of his hope and light.

Be kind. Yes, even to that person.
